Shillong, the capital of Meghalaya, is a mesmerizing hill station known for its lush landscapes, cascading waterfalls, and vibrant culture. Often referred to as the “Scotland of the East,” Shillong offers a perfect blend of natural beauty and urban charm. Whether you’re a nature lover, history enthusiast, or adventure seeker, Shillong has something for everyone. Here are some of the top places to visit in Shillong.
1. Elephant Falls
One of the most famous waterfalls in Shillong, Elephant Falls is a three-tiered cascade surrounded by dense greenery. Named by the British due to a rock resembling an elephant (which no longer exists), this waterfall is a must-visit for its scenic beauty and tranquil ambiance. Visitors can take a short trek down to witness the different levels of the falls.
2. Umiam Lake
Located about 15 kilometers from Shillong, Umiam Lake is a stunning man-made reservoir that offers breathtaking views and a range of water activities. Whether you want to go boating, kayaking, or simply enjoy a peaceful picnic by the lake, Umiam is a perfect getaway for nature lovers.
3. Shillong Peak
For panoramic views of Shillong and beyond, Shillong Peak is the place to be. At an elevation of 1,965 meters, this viewpoint provides a spectacular bird’s-eye view of the city, the surrounding hills, and even parts of Bangladesh on a clear day. It’s an ideal spot for photography and sightseeing.

4. Lady Hydari Park
A well-maintained park named after the wife of the first Governor of Assam, Lady Hydari Park is a beautiful place to relax and unwind. With manicured gardens, a mini zoo, and a serene atmosphere, it’s a great spot for families and nature enthusiasts.
5. Don Bosco Museum
For those interested in the rich cultural heritage of Northeast India, the Don Bosco Museum is a must-visit. This seven-story museum showcases artifacts, costumes, and traditions of various indigenous tribes, offering a deep insight into the region’s history and diversity.
6. Cathedral of Mary Help of Christians
This stunning cathedral is one of the most iconic landmarks in Shillong. With its Gothic-style architecture and serene surroundings, the Cathedral of Mary Help of Christians is a peaceful place for reflection and admiration.
7. Air Force Museum
Located in Upper Shillong, the Air Force Museum is an interesting place for aviation enthusiasts. It displays aircraft models, uniforms, and historical artifacts related to the Indian Air Force, making it an educational and engaging visit.
8. Butterfly Museum
A hidden gem in Shillong, the Butterfly Museum houses a fascinating collection of butterflies and moths from across the region. It’s a great place for nature lovers and those interested in entomology.
9. Diengiei Peak
For adventure seekers, Diengiei Peak offers a thrilling trekking experience. Located near Shillong, this peak provides stunning views of the surrounding valleys and is a great spot for hiking and exploration.
